Minificador de JavaScript
Minimize seu JavaScript rapidamente. Arquivos menores, carregamentos mais rápidos. Sem complicações.
Sobre Esta Ferramenta
Olha, entendo—escrever JavaScript limpo e legível é importante. Mas quando chega a hora de publicar, você não quer que seu código esteja inchado com espaços extras, comentários e nomes de variáveis longos. É aí que entra um minificador de JavaScript. Ele remove toda a "gordura" e compacta seu código em algo menor, mais rápido e pronto para produção. Isso não é mágica. É apenas compressão inteligente. O minificador remove caracteres desnecessários—como espaços em branco e quebras de linha—sem alterar a forma como seu código executa. Ele também encurta os nomes de variáveis e funções (geralmente para letras únicas), o que economiza ainda mais espaço. O resultado? Tempos de carregamento mais rápidos e menos largura de banda utilizada. Simples.Principais Funcionalidades
- Remove comentários e espaços em branco extras—afinal, quem precisa disso em produção?
- Encurta nomes de variáveis e funções para reduzir o tamanho do arquivo.
- Preserva a funcionalidade do código—seu app continua funcionando, só que mais enxuto.
- Funciona com JavaScript moderno, incluindo sintaxe ES6+.
- Pode ser integrado a ferramentas de build como Webpack ou Gulp.
- Muitas vezes inclui ofuscação opcional para dificultar a engenharia reversa.
- Processamento rápido—a maioria dos arquivos é minificada em menos de um segundo.
Perguntas Frequentes
A minificação vai quebrar meu código?
Geralmente não—se seu código estiver bem escrito. Mas se você depender dos nomes das variáveis para depuração (como em mensagens de erro), as coisas podem ficar confusas. Por isso, você deve sempre testar seu código minificado antes de implantá-lo. Além disso, evite usar eval() ou instruções with—elas não se dão bem com minificadores.
Devo minificar durante o desenvolvimento?
Não. Mantenha seu código original e legível enquanto estiver construindo e testando. Minifique apenas para produção. A maioria dos desenvolvedores usa scripts de build para automatizar essa etapa, então você não precisa se preocupar com isso. Basta escrever código limpo e deixar a ferramenta cuidar do resto.